Man robbed at knifepoint in Atwater

Atwater police are looking for a man who robbed another man at knifepoint over the weekend, the Police Department reported.

Police say a Latino man in his 50s approached a victim around 8:35 p.m. Saturday in the 1100 block of Ash Street. He placed a knife with a blue handle to the victim’s neck and demanded money, Lt. Samuel Joseph said.

The thief took about $400 in cash, threw the knife down and ran away, investigators said.

Police said the victim had recently cashed a paycheck.

The victim was not injured, police said.
